On Mon, Jul 28, 2014 at 11:45 AM, Julien Le Dem <[email protected]> wrote: > Notes: > > Attendees: > Carl: Genome rich. interest: SparqSql. (ParquetRDD) > Dan, Tongjie: Netflix. interest: PR to review. > Frank Austin from berkeley on the Adam project. interest: Predicate > pushdown > Jacques: Drill. interest: DateTime PR, > Mickael: Criteo. > Ryan Blue: Cloudera. interest: project that integrates avro and Parquet > > Agenda > - How many active committers, better way to look at PR. > - identify people with expertise per component. > - non contentious => should just merge. > - action: Julien, email the committers, identify expertise. > - build a group of committers more engaged. > - Predicate pushdown, backward incompatible changes? > - PR #4: added new filter API that applies both to row groups and > records > - did not remove the old API. Plan to move towards unifying the two. > The new API should be a superset of the old. > - we should deprecate the old API. > - action: Frank to propose an integration to wrap the old API in the > new API. (given time) > - Semantic versioning: enforced in the pom.xml.
